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Lisbon to Channel Islands is to fly which costs $85 - $350 and takes 6h 36m.
The fastest way to get from Lisbon to Channel Islands is to fly which takes 6h 36m and costs $85 - $350.
The distance between Lisbon and Channel Islands is 1288 km.
The best way to get from Lisbon to Channel Islands without a car is to bus and car ferry via Nantes which takes 30h 27m and costs $200 - $450.
It takes approximately 6h 36m to get from Lisbon to Channel Islands, including transfers.
There are 54+ hotels available in Channel Islands.
What companies run services between Lisbon, Portugal and Channel Islands, Guernsey?
easyJet, British Airways, and two other airlines fly from Lisbon-Portela Airport (LIS) to Jersey Airport (JER) 4 times a day.
